Golden is one of 14 designated Resort Municipalities in British Columbia. As a resort municipality, Golden receives tourism funding through the Resort Municipality Initiative (RMI) program. The Resort Development Strategy (RDS) is a required plan that outlines how approximately $2.5 million in RMI funding will be invested in local tourism projects, events and experiences over the next three years.

About RMI:
The RMI program is intended to support small, tourism-based municipalities to build and diversify their tourism infrastructure, deliver exceptional visitor experiences and incorporate sustainable tourism practices and products.
